Where is my App Store API key?

To get your key ID, copy it from App Store Connect by logging in to App Store Connect, then: Select Users and Access, then select the API Keys tab. The key IDs appear in a column under the Active heading . Hover the cursor next to a key ID to display the Copy Key ID link.

Does Apple have an API?

The Sign in with Apple REST API is a web service that connects you to Apple’s authentication servers. Use this service to generate and validate the identity tokens used to verify a user’s identity. To sign in from a web app or other platform, like Android, use Sign in with Apple JS .

What is the API for the App Store?

Overview. The App Store Server API is a REST API that you call from your server to request and provide information about your customers’ in-app purchases . The App Store signs the transaction and subscription renewal information that this API returns using the JSON Web Signature (JWS) specification.
